Donald Trump Invites PM Modi to US: US Secretary of State Marco Rubio met Prime Minister Narendra Modi at ‘Seva Tirth’ in Delhi and gave him a special invitation to visit America on behalf of President Donald Trump. Many issues were seriously discussed in the meeting that lasted for more than an hour between the two leaders.

Trump Modi Meeting News: US President Donald Trump has sent a special invitation to Prime Minister Narendra Modi to visit America. The special thing is that America’s Foreign Minister Marco Rubio himself took this call to Delhi on Saturday and met PM Modi at ‘Seva Teerth’. This invitation of Trump has come at a time when just 7 days ago he was on a visit to China and there he had praised Chinese President Xi Jinping profusely. In such a situation, the question is arising that why suddenly America remembered India so much?

Is this America’s damage control plan?

American media and New York Times believe that there is a big reason behind this step of Trump. Just last week, when Trump went to China, he called Xi Jinping his ‘great friend’ and ‘great leader’. This statement of Trump had increased some uneasiness in the politics of entire Asia, especially in India. According to experts, the Trump government is aware of this, that is why it immediately sent its most trusted and tough leader against China, Marco Rubio, to India. The conversation between Rubio and PM Modi lasted for more than an hour. The real objective of this tour is to assure India that India is the most sure and important partner in Asia for America.

Why is there a tussle between America and India?

Nobel Prize and tariff dispute

Last year, Trump wanted PM Modi to nominate him for the Nobel Peace Prize, because Trump claimed that he had stopped the India-Pakistan conflict. When India rejected this claim, Trump got angry and imposed heavy tariffs on Indian goods.

sudden closeness to pakistan

Recently, Trump praised the leaders of Pakistan and called them the ‘arbitrator’ who brought about peace in the Iran war. This did not send a good message to India.

cheaper oil than russia

India is continuously buying cheap crude oil for its needs from Russia, while America wants India to reduce oil purchases from Russia and import oil and gas (LNG) from America.

Who will get what from India-America meeting?

There was not only talk between PM Modi and the US Secretary of State on removing old resentment, but many big decisions were also taken for the future which will double India’s strength in the future.

1. Working together in high-tech and factories

Now both the countries together are preparing to compete with China in terms of technology. In the coming days, India may see major American investment in the field of semiconductor (chip), advanced battery and Artificial Intelligence (AI). This will create new job opportunities for the youth of the country.

2. Defense super-partnership

The Indian Army is already using many modern US weapons such as SkyGuardian drones, howitzer cannons and Globemaster aircraft. Now the new plan is that both the countries will not just buy weapons, but will also jointly produce weapons on Indian soil.
